| Criteria | Requirement |
|---|---|
| Minimum Age | 18 years (21 years for B1/B2 licence issue) |
| Education | 10+2 with Physics & Maths OR B.Tech/Diploma in Engineering |
| English | ICAO English proficiency (reading + writing) |
| Medical | No specific medical required for training |
| Experience (B1.1) | 3 years post-qualification practical experience for licence issue |
| Experience (B2) | 5 years post-qualification practical experience for licence issue |
